Engineering Associate – Stormwater Investigator

Hillsborough County

Engineering Associate investigating, assessing, and managing public infrastructure under licensed engineer supervision. Providing engineering support and ensuring project completion on budget and schedule.

About the role

Key responsibilities & impact
  • Applies broad knowledge of principles and practices to the planning, design support, construction, assessment, asset management, and maintenance of multiple municipal projects, or portions of major projects; resolves conflicts and ensures compliance with permits and regulations; prepares and monitors scopes, budgets, and schedules to ensure timely completion of projects.
  • Provides engineering support in the design of complete projects, systems, components of processes, including project documents.
  • Drafts or revises plans and drawings utilizing computer-aided design tools.
  • Plans, research, and conduct environmental and mapping surveys; performs cost analysis and feasibility studies.
  • Prepares contract drafts; evaluates contractor proposals and assists with review of proposals for professional engineering services.
  • Conducts reviews of permit applications.
  • Analyzes and interprets data; formulates and solves problems; makes recommendations based on findings.
  • Attends project meetings and presents specific aspects of engineering assignments, such as whether assigned projects are on schedule and established within budget.
  • May assign tasks to, direct, and mentor lower-level Engineering Associates and Engineering Technicians.
  • Other duties as assigned.

Requirements

What you’ll need
  • Bachelor’s degree from an accredited college or university with major in Engineering Bachelor’s degree from an accredited college or university with a major in an Engineering-related field
  • Ten years of experience in the planning, assessment, design, construction, inspection of public infrastructure projects, or modeling of water, wastewater, stormwater, or traffic systems
  • An equivalent combination of education (not less than possession of a High School diploma/GED), training and experience that would reasonably be expected to provide the job-related competencies noted above
